MID-PRAIRIE BASEBALL

No. 1-ranked Golden Hawks win 7th straight game

Posted

WELLMAN

A pair of two-hit games by Mid-Prairie senior Cain Brown helped lead the top-ranked Golden Hawks to a doubleheader sweep of West Branch on Friday, extending their win streak to seven games.

Mid-Prairie (9-2), which is ranked No. 1 in Class 2A, has not lost since May 22 to River Valley Conference rival Monticello. The Golden Hawks’ only other loss was to Johnston, the No. 4-ranked team in Class 4A, the first week of the season.

Brown had two hits and drove in two runs in a 6-2 win in the first game of a doubleheader against West Branch, then added two hits in the 6-0 win in Game 2. He also pitched two scoreless innings in Game 2.

Golden Hawks pitcher Alex Bean struck out seven in the opening game win, and Brady Weber, returning from a knee injury, struck out eight in the second game.

Mid-Prairie will play a doubleheader Monday at Wilton.
